Output 1b8e50d360fe0640b2f0928ca0b1cdd0ac9413c33158421aec8ea3047de7c6ce:1

value
2593000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b34bb480fc7f91cb82ad854f212e20ab3debb87 OP_EQUAL
address
3BTsPvVvWyg1kLgXKH4k9zGvTrCbWt9Q8T
transaction
1b8e50d360fe0640b2f0928ca0b1cdd0ac9413c33158421aec8ea3047de7c6ce
confirmations
457441
spent
true